The primary mission for the team is to lead the definition of various architectures and the compiler stack for new hardware accelerators for Deep Learning. Key responsibilities will include proposing new concepts in software that applies compilers to exercise the hardware architecture features of AI accelerators, implementing optimizations to generate programs and evaluating performance benefits using the software simulators across different use-cases, determining hardware/software techniques to improve performance. Further responsibilities include performing research and development of novel software solutions and evaluating their merits relative to state-of-the-art solutions and demonstrating external eminence by publishing the outcomes of the research.
